Ryzen 7 1700X vs Ryzen 5 7530U benchmarks
In our benchmarks, the Ryzen 5 7530U beats the Ryzen 7 1700X in overall performance. Furthermore, our gaming benchmark shows that it also outperforms the Ryzen 7 1700X in all gaming tests too.
When comparing core counts for these CPUs, we notice that the Ryzen 7 1700X has slightly more cores with 8 cores compared to the Ryzen 5 7530U that has 6 cores. It also has more threads than the Ryzen 5 7530U. These CPUs have different clock speeds. Indeed, the Ryzen 7 1700X has a significantly higher clock speed compared to the Ryzen 5 7530U. Despite this, the Ryzen 5 7530U has a slightly higher turbo speed. The Ryzen 5 7530U outputs less heat than Ryzen 7 1700X thanks to a significantly lower TDP. This measures the amount of heat they output and can be used to estimate power consumption. In terms of cache, the Ryzen 7 1700X has slightly more L2 cache when compared to the Ryzen 5 7530U. However, both these chips have the same amount of L3 cache.
Modern CPUs generally have more logical cores than physical cores, this means that each core is split into multiple virtual cores, improving efficiency for parallel workloads. Indeed, the Ryzen 7 1700X has more threads than cores. Each physical core is split into multiple threads.
